James Purdey, London. Best 12ga. self-opening sidelock, light weight, game gun completed ca. 1886.  Weight: 6 lbs. 10 oz.  Stock Dimensions: 15”x 1 ½”x 2 ½”x 3/8” cast-off.  Very nice 30” chopper-lump steel barrels with 2 ½” chambers have excellent bores (.733”/.734”), choked .006”/.006”, and minimum wall thicknesses of .030”/.030”. Barrels are old replacements, likely done by the maker, and have a few very minor exterior dings. Early self-opening action, nicely engraved, with the beautifully sculpted fences typical of the early guns, retains a fair amount of the original hardening color and has all the most desirable features including hidden third fasteners, bushed firing pins, automatic safety, and double triggers. Very nicely figured straight-grip stock with 1” wood extension. Splinter forend. Overall tight, mechanically perfect, and a very solid working gun well worth the money.
